Ricky Martin Overhears WGN Reporter's Fan Freakout

Ana Belaval didn't realize the singer could still hear her when she started gushing after an interview.

CHICAGO, IL — A WGN reporter had a fangirl meltdown after interviewing Ricky Martin on live TV — only to discover the singer heard every word of it. "Around Town" reporter Ana Belaval wasn't in the WGN studio for the satellite interview with the singer, but as a longtime fan, she begged entertainment reporter Dean Richards to let her be part of the broadcast.

Afterwards, Belaval, who was raised in Puerto Rico, began gushing to her coworkers about Martin after asking him about his efforts to help with Hurricane Maria relief.

"You have to understand, when you're part of a minority, and you don't have a lot of role models in media, and you have a Ricky Martin that wherever you go in the world, it's a good name to mention as a Puerto Rican, oh my goodness, you feel related to him."

Belaval continued her fangirl moment, exclaiming, "He called me mama, baby!" Martin, who was still listening, chimed in, "That's beautiful."

As the realization dawned on her, Belaval said to her coworkers, "He's still here? I'm going to kill you!"

Martin took it in stride, "I want to see her," he said of Belaval. "I want to hug her."

Belaval joked about the incident on Facebook, sharing a clip of the interview and writing, "This is when I still had my dignity in front of Ricky Martin."

She went on to add, "Next dream, to meet him and travel with him and Habitat for Humanity to #puertorico to build some homes. And yes, I am very proud of gushing over one of our best!"
